What Are Smart Contracts in the Supply Chain?
Smart contracts in the supply chain refer to self-executing contracts with terms directly written into lines of code. They automatically trigger actions or events when predefined conditions are met, ensuring trustworthiness without the need for intermediaries.
Smart contracts automate and streamline processes such as payments, order placements, and inventory tracking within the supply chain context.
By utilizing blockchain technology, these contracts guarantee transparency, traceability, and security across transactions, enabling parties to engage in seamless, tamper-proof exchanges and collaborations.
This digitization of contracts aids in reducing fraud, speeding up operations, and enhancing supply chain efficiency and visibility.

What Are the 4 Key Challenges Faced in Implementing Smart Contracts in Supply Chain?
The integration of smart contracts into supply chain management holds the promise of increased efficiency, transparency, and security. This promising evolution is not without its hurdles.
Let’s now identify these hurdles –

1. The Complexity of Integration
Many businesses run on legacy systems that aren’t inherently compatible with blockchain technology.
For instance, when Maersk teamed up with IBM to introduce TradeLens, a blockchain-based supply chain solution, the challenge wasn’t just in developing the platform but ensuring it interfaced with diverse systems across global ports, customs, and shippers.
According to a Gartner report, through 2021, 90% of current enterprise blockchain platform implementations required replacement within 18 months to remain competitive, compliant, and secure.
2. Regulatory Hurdles
Regulatory landscapes can vary significantly by country and industry. De Beers, the diamond giant, introduced its “Tracr” platform to ensure diamonds’ authenticity and non-conflict status.
While promising, they had to maneuver through myriad regulations related to diamond sourcing and trade, not just from one country but several.
A Deloitte survey found that 48% of respondents saw regulatory concerns as a barrier to blockchain investment.
3. Data Privacy and Security
Blockchain’s transparent nature can sometimes conflict with data privacy regulations. For example, Walmart, after employing a blockchain system to track produce from farm to store, had to ensure that customer and business data remained private while still leveraging the transparent benefits of blockchain.
The World Economic Forum states that cybersecurity is a top concern for businesses considering blockchain adoption.
4. Interoperability Issues
The decentralized nature of blockchain can lead to challenges in creating standardized systems that communicate efficiently.
FedEx, when attempting to integrate blockchain for its logistics and supply chain, had to ensure that the solutions it developed would work across the multitude of technologies in its vast network.
According to a Forrester report, only 13% of companies said the blockchain solution they implemented was interoperable with their existing systems.
Tackling these challenges is essential for companies looking to harness the full potential of smart contracts in their supply chain management. Collaboration and innovation are pivotal in turning these challenges into opportunities as technology evolves.
What Strategies Can Companies Employ to Overcome the Challenges?
Here, we have discussed the five most important strategies for companies to overcome challenges when implementing smart contracts in supply chain management:

1. Thorough Planning and Analysis
Prior to embarking on smart contract implementation, engage in comprehensive planning and analysis. Scrutinize your current systems, processes, and workflows to pinpoint potential integration opportunities and foresee challenges.
This proactive approach enhances your comprehension of how smart contracts align with your ongoing operations and reveals areas necessitating adjustments.
Key Steps for Smart Contract Implementation Preparation:
- Evaluate existing systems and technology.
- Analyze current processes and workflows.
- Identify potential integration points.
- Anticipate and prepare for challenges.
- Gain a clear understanding of how smart contracts will fit into your operations.
2. Collaborative Ecosystem Engagement
Effective supply chain management hinges on engaging stakeholders like suppliers, partners, and regulatory bodies. Collaboration fosters not only interoperability, enabling seamless interaction between systems, but also regulatory compliance.
By working together, supply chain actors can ensure that smart contract implementations adhere to legal frameworks. Establishing best practices in smart contract deployment across the sector, driving efficiency and trust.
3. Privacy-Focused Design
Prioritize data privacy by implementing a privacy-focused design for your smart contracts. Utilize techniques like zero-knowledge proofs, where parties can prove the validity of a statement without revealing the specific data, ensuring sensitive information remains confidential.
Consider employing off-chain data storage for susceptible data that doesn’t need to be stored directly on the blockchain.
4. Regulatory Alignment
Work closely with legal experts to ensure your smart contracts align with existing regulations. Engage legal teams to review and validate contract terms and conditions, ensuring compliance with local and international laws.
Address potential conflicts and ambiguities early on and adjust to avoid regulatory hurdles.

2. Contract Validity and Legal Recognition
Smart contracts must seamlessly integrate into existing legal frameworks to ensure their validity and enforceability. This entails aligning electronic contracts with traditional contract law principles, including a clear offer, acceptance, consideration, and intention to create legal relations.
Parties should also consider the jurisdiction where the contract will be enforced, as legal requirements may vary. Smart contracts can gain legal recognition by addressing these aspects, facilitating smooth dispute resolution and contract execution.
3. Digital Identity Standards
Verifying participants’ identities in smart contracts is pivotal for trust and security. Parties can leverage decentralized identity systems and blockchain-based identity solutions to comply with authentication standards.
These technologies enable secure and privacy-preserving identity verification, reducing the risk of identity fraud.
Cryptographic techniques like zero-knowledge proofs allow parties to validate their identities without revealing sensitive personal information, striking a balance between security and privacy.

7. Intellectual Property and Licensing
Smart contracts should respect intellectual property rights and licensing agreements. By embedding these rights within contract terms, creators and innovators can ensure their work is protected and receive appropriate compensation.
Smart contracts can automate royalty payments and licensing conditions, streamlining the process and reducing the risk of intellectual property disputes within blockchain-based ecosystems.
8. Taxation and Tariffs
Adhering to diverse tax regulations and tariffs is critical for cross-border transactions within smart contracts. Parties involved in international trade via blockchain must ensure compliance with tax laws to prevent legal complications.
Smart contracts can be programmed to automatically calculate and remit taxes and tariffs, reducing the administrative burden and enhancing transparency in financial transactions. Proper tax compliance also avoids potential legal penalties and ensures the smooth flow of goods and services across borders.
